A cross-omics analysis in the general population has identified distinct DNA methylation signatures associated with bilateral hippocampal volume, asymmetry, and atrophy. Researchers demonstrated that these epigenetic profiles are significantly linked to structural brain changes relevant to neuropsychiatric and neurodegenerative conditions.
